DNN 4.5.3 Simple ClientAPI getVar() Error - Object doesn't support this property or method 
Modified By Tigris7  on 1/31/2008 11:23:06 AM)

I am attempting to pass a variable to clients side script,edit the value, and return it to server side. To start with, for testing, I did the following in the server side:

If ClientAPI.BrowserSupportsFunctionality(ClientAPI.ClientFunctionality.DHTML) Then

    ClientAPI.RegisterClientVariable(Page, "Of", "Frank", True)
    DNNClientAPI.AddBodyOnloadEventHandler(MyBase.Page, "GetURL()")   

End If

So this calls function GetURL() on the client side in the page load event. In GetURL I have:

function GetURL()

{

    var sOF = dnn.getVar('Of');

}

    this line alone causes a 'Object doesn't support this Property or Method" javascript error

What am I doing wrong? For testing I put GetURL() in the dnncore.js file and I am calling it from admin/security/signin.ascx.
